Trends in the Food and Beverage Industry

Trinity Logistics

The food and beverage industry has faced significant challenges and growth over the past couple of years. After several unpredictable years, many hope we’ll see more stability back in the industry. In this blog, we’re going to dive into some of the latest trends in the food and beverage industry.

Supply Chain Trends to Watch for 2023 and Beyond

MTS Logistics

Various factors will continue to influence Supply Chain Management trends in 2023 and beyond. Inflationary trends are affecting the world economy and directly affect supply chain and delivery operations. Warehousing is also expected to have problems providing sufficient labor to meet demand.
